What happens if you kick the ball in kickball?

In kickball, the ball is rolled to the person at home plate who tries to kick it. If the ball is kicked into the air, it can be caught and the kicker is out. If the ball bounces, the ball may be thrown at the player who kicked the ball. If the player is hit by the ball and he is not on a base, then he is out.

What muscles do you use when playing kickball?

The glutes and hamstrings, as well as the adductors, control your hips. The hamstrings and quads flex and extend your knees, and the plantar flexors flex your ankles. Your abs and lower back muscles stabilize your trunk, and your deltoids align your shoulders square to the ball.

What is kickball game?

Kickball is a playground game and competitive league game, similar to baseball, invented in the United States. The game is typically played on a softball diamond with a 10- to 16-inch inflated rubber ball. As in baseball/softball, the game uses 3 bases and a home plate.
